Bug Extermination Service in Frisco, TX
Bug extermination services focus on identifying and eliminating pests such as ants, termites, cockroaches, and other common insects that can invade residential properties. These services typically cover a range of projects, including infested kitchens, basements, attics, and outdoor areas where pests may gather. Homeowners often seek these services to restore comfort, protect property structures, and prevent potential damage caused by pests, especially in regions like Frisco, TX where certain insects are prevalent.
Before requesting bug extermination, property owners usually want to understand the extent of the infestation, the types of pests involved, and the methods used for removal. It’s also helpful to know whether the treatment involves chemical solutions or more natural approaches, and if any precautions are necessary during and after the service. Clear communication about the scope of work and any follow-up treatments can assist homeowners in making informed decisions about pest control solutions.

Bug Extermination Service Questions
What types of pests can be treated? Bug extermination services typically address common pests such as ants, cockroaches, spiders, termites, and bed bugs.
How do extermination treatments work? Treatments involve applying targeted solutions to eliminate pests and prevent future infestations, often including both chemical and non-chemical methods.
Are there any preparations needed before treatment? Property owners may be advised to clear affected areas and follow specific guidelines to ensure the effectiveness of pest control efforts.
Is follow-up needed after initial treatment? Follow-up inspections or treatments might be recommended to ensure pests are fully eradicated and to address any new activity.
